    What is the Canonical Tag Generator?

    Generate canonical link tags to consolidate duplicate content and control which URL version Google indexes.

    The Canonical Tag Generator creates the <link rel='canonical'> HTML element that tells search engines which URL is the 'master' version of a page. E-commerce sites, blogs with URL parameters, and sites with www/non-www variations all face duplicate content issues. Without canonical tags, Google may index the wrong version or split ranking signals across duplicates. This tool generates valid canonical tags and explains when and how to use them.

    Common Use Cases

    • E-commerce sites with filter/sort URL parameters
    • Sites with www and non-www versions both accessible
    • Pages accessible via HTTP and HTTPS
    • Blogs with pagination or category/tag duplicates
    • Content syndication where originals and copies both exist

    Pro Tips

    • Self-referencing canonicals (pointing to the current URL) are best practice for all pages
    • Canonicals are hints, not directives - Google may ignore them if the pages are too different
    • Use 301 redirects for true duplicates; canonicals for near-duplicates with valid reasons to exist
    • Check canonicals with browser dev tools or GSC URL Inspection tool
